Censorship and Free Speech: The Tension Between Social Media and the First Amendment

This chapter explores the tensions related to censorship claims on social media, focusing on the experiences of conservative and pro-Palestinian voices. It highlights a court hearing that delves into the impact of the First Amendment on private platform speech and the broader implications for free speech and corporate content moderation.
